The next-generation wireless mobile networks are characterized by heterogeneity with a variety of different networks co-existence. To provide robust performance and flexible adjustment, we propose an Utility-based Weighted Prioritization (UWP) scheme for handoff operations in heterogeneous wireless networks. Cognitive radio wireless networks is an emerging communication paradigm to effectively address spectrum scarcity challenge. Spectrum sharing enables the secondary unlicensed system to dynamically access the licensed frequency bands in the primary system without any modification to the devices, terminals, services and networks in the primary system.
